When you re-level it, do you pull the slides in and automatic re-level it or do it manually?
I usually have a million things out and it would be hard to pull all 5 slides in and use the automatic. I put it in manual mode and give each position (front, rear, left, and right) a momentary push of the button watching for movement of the coach. Of course when all 4 have been pushed I may have to hit one of the positions to turn off the light that indicates a low position at that point.
I have also made 6 blocks out of treated lumber (2x10 and 2 ply) that I now place under the Jack pads when I feel I am on soft ground. It helps somewhat.
